Jay Inslee should take the hint and use his emergency ... Web10 de ago. de 2024 · Employees seeking an exemption from the WA Cares Fund and payroll tax must be at least 18 years old. Employees must purchase a qualifying private long-term care insurance plan before November 1, 2024. If you want to know more about what alternative plans may qualify, you can visit the Office of the Insurance …
